LUBRICATING SYSTEM
Main Oil Filter (Cartridge Type Paper Element)
Replacement Procedure
1. Drain the engine oil.
2. Retighten the drain plug.
3. Loosen the used oil filter by turning it counterclockwise
with a filter wrench.
Filter Wrench: 5-8840-0200-0


RTW36ASH000101


4. Clean the oil cooler fitting face. This will allow the new
oil filter to seat properly.
5. Apply a light coat of engine oil to the filter O-ring.
6. Turn in the new oil filter until the filter O-ring is fitted
against the sealing face.
7. Use the filter wrench to turn in the filter an additional
2/3 turns.
8. Check the engine oil level and replenish to the
specified level if required.

FUEL SYSTEM
Fuel Filter Replacement Procedure
1. Remove the fuel filter by turning it counterclockwise
with a filter wrench.
Filter Wrench: 5-8840-0253-0 (J-22700)
Note:
Be careful not to spill the fuel in the filter cartridge.






RTW46ASH000501








2. Clean the fuel filter cartridge fitting faces.
This will allow the new fuel filter to seat properly
3. Apply a light coat of engine oil to the O-ring.
4. Turn in the fuel filter until the sealing face comes in
contact with the O-ring.
5. Turn in the fuel filter an additional 2/3 of a turn with a
filter wrench.
Filter Wrench : 5-8840-0253-0 (J-22700)





6. Operate the priming pump until the air discharged
completely from fuel system.
7. Start the engine and check for fuel leakage.
Note:
The use of an ISUZU genuine fuel filter is strongly
recommended.

COOLING SYSTEM
Coolant Level
Check the coolant level and replenish the radiator reserve
tank as necessary.
If the coolant level falls below the “MIN” line, carefully
check the cooling system for leakage. Then add enough
coolant to bring the level up to the “MAX” line.




Engine coolant Filling up procedure
1. Make sure that the engine is cool.
Warning:
When the coolant is heated to a high temperature, be
sure not to loosen or remove the rediator cap.
Otherwise you might get scalded by hot vapor or
boiling water.
To open the radiator cap, put a piece of thick cloth on
the cap and loosen the cap slowly to reduce the
pressure when the coolant has become cooler.
2. Open rediator cap pour coolant up to filler neck
3. Pour coolant into reservoir tank up to “MAX” line
4. Tighten radiator cap and start the engine. After idling
for 2 to 3 minutes, stop the engine and reopen radiator
cap. If the water level is lower, replenish.
5. After replenish the coolant tighten radiator cap, warm
up the engine at about 2000 rpm. Set heater
adjustment to the highest temperature position, and let
the coolant circulate also into heater water system.
6. Check to see the thermometer, continuously idling 5
minutes and stop the engine.
7. When the engine has been cooled, check filler neck
for water level and replenish if required. Should
extreme shortage of coolant is found, check the
coolant system and reservoir tank hose for leakage.
8. Pour coolant into the reservoir tank up to “MAX” line.

Engine Coolant Total Capacity Lit (U.S / UK gal)

4JA1 / TC 9.4 (2.5 / 2.1)
4JH1TC M/T: 10.1 (2.7 / 2.2)
A/T: 10.0 (2.6 / 2.2)
Mixing Ratio (Anti-Freeze Solution/Water)
50 %

Thermostat Operating Test
1. Completely submerge the thermostat in water.
2. Heat the water.
Stir the water constantly to avoid direct heat being
applied to the thermostat.
3. Check the thermostat initial opening temperature.
Thermostat Initial Opening Temperature C (F)
82 (180)
Oil Cooler Thermo Valve C (F)
76.5 (170)
EGR Cooler Thermo Valve C (F)
40 (104)

4. Check the thermostat full opening temperature.
Thermostat Full Opening Temperature C (F)
95 (203)
Oil Cooler Thermo Valve C (F)
90 (194)
EGR Cooler Thermo Valve C (F)
55 (131)
Valve Lift at Fully Open position mm (in)
9.5 (0.37)
Oil Cooler Thermo Valve mm (in)
4.5 (0.18)
EGR Cooler Thermo Valve mm in)
3.5 (0.14)

Engine Warm-Up
After completing the required maintenance procedures,
start the engine and allow it to idle until it is warm.
Check the following:
1. Engine idling speed.
2. Engine noise level.
3. Engine lubricating system and cooling system.
Carefully check for oil and coolant leakage.
4. Clutch engagement.
5. Transmission operation.
6. Indicator warning light operation.
